Dolakner
Dolakner is a locality in Lake Sevan Region, Armenia and has an elevation of 1,957 metres. Dolakner is situated nearby to the locality Kamo Kaghak, as well as near the village Karmirgyugh.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Gavarr
Town
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Gavar is a town in Armenia serving as the administrative centre of the Gavar Municipality and the Gegharkunik Province. It is situated among the high mountains of Gegham range to the west of Lake Sevan, with an average height of 1982 meters above sea level.
Atsarat
Village
Hatsarat is a town in the Gegharkunik Province of Armenia. The town contains a small domed church built in 898. Atsarat is situated 2½ km west of Dolakner.
